abcnews.go.com — Young voters at Drexel University in Philadelphia, Penn. have already been targeted, with students reporting that flyers have been posted around campus warning that undercover police will be at the polls on Election Day looking to make arrests.

You didn't read the article. Cops aren't really going to be patrolling polling places, looking for people with outstanding warrants (I'm pretty sure that it's illegal, at least in most places, because I'd hear about it happening in Mississippi if it were legal--trust me). People are trying to suppress voter turnout by spreading this disinformation in college and minority communities.It's sort of like when they pass out fliers indicating that Democrats should actually vote on Wednesday, or when the actual police set up roadblocks in black neighborhoods on voting day.
